Introduction
Who they are / where they are based
Optimism is a community-driven organization focused on scaling Ethereum through Layer 2 solutions. The Optimism DAO operates within the Ethereum ecosystem, enabling faster and cheaper transactions while maintaining the security of the Ethereum blockchain. It is based virtually, with contributors from all over the world.
History
The Optimism project began in 2019 when the team started working on a Layer 2 scaling solution designed to improve the Ethereum blockchain's transaction throughput. In 2021, the project launched its mainnet and introduced the Optimism DAO, allowing community members to participate in governance and decision-making processes. Over time, the DAO has evolved to embrace a broader set of stakeholders, including developers, users, and investors.
Context
Ethereum has faced scalability challenges due to its popularity and high transaction fees. Optimism DAO was created to address these issues by providing a solution that allows for quicker transactions without sacrificing security. As decentralized finance (DeFi) and non-fungible tokens (NFTs) gained popularity, the demand for efficient transaction processing became critical, making the role of Optimism more pronounced.

Scope / product / services
Optimism offers a Layer 2 scaling solution that enables:
Low-cost transactions: Users experience significantly lower gas fees.
Fast transaction processing: Optimism's rollups allow for quicker confirmations compared to Ethereum's Layer 1.
Compatibility with Ethereum: dApps can be deployed on Optimism without significant changes to their codebase, ensuring a seamless transition for developers.
The Optimism ecosystem includes various tools and integrations that support developers, such as SDKs and documentation, to facilitate the creation of new dApps.

Implementation
Permissions
Permissions within the Optimism DAO are structured to enable all community members to participate in governance, submit proposals, and vote. This open model encourages broad participation and democratizes decision-making.
Governance & Decision-Making
The governance framework is based on a token-based voting system where holders of the OP token can propose and vote on changes to the protocol, funding allocations, and other critical decisions. The governance process is designed to be transparent, with proposals discussed openly before being put to a vote.

Community & Participation
Community engagement is facilitated through various channels, including Discord and forums, where members can discuss ideas, propose initiatives, and collaborate on projects. Regular community calls and events are held to keep members informed and involved.
Legal entity form
Optimism DAO operates as a decentralized autonomous organization without a traditional corporate structure, but it is linked to the Optimism Foundation, which provides legal support and ensures compliance with relevant regulations.
Technology & Tools
Optimism utilizes various technologies and tools to facilitate governance and collaboration:
Governance Tools: The DAO uses tools like Snapshot for off-chain governance voting, ensuring that community members can participate in governance without incurring gas fees.
Collaboration Tools: Discord serves as the primary platform for community discussions, while GitHub is used for code contributions and project management.
